Abstract

Recently, there has been intensive focus on turbo product codes(TPCs) which have low decoding complexity and achieve near optimum performances at low signal-to noise ratios. This paper presents a parallel algorithm of turbo product codes enable simultaneous decoding of row and column. The row and column decoders operate in parallel and update each other after row and column has been decoded. Decoding is halted after row and column decoder has same decoded bits.
